On a show like Stranger Things, death seems inevitable. Of course, by adding all sorts of dangerous, bloodthirsty monsters to the universe, the writers had to pick a few victims to murder in order to raise the stakes for viewers. No one wants to see the characters protected all the time, so sooner or later even fan favorites found themselves in danger.

The death of Joe Quinn's Eddie Munson at the end of season 4 was a moment many fans have yet to get over. Not only was it the end of his glorious redemption arc, but it was also a stark reminder that no Stranger Things character is ever truly safe. Ranking all the character deaths so far, fans still find his to be the most devastating.

How Did Eddie Munson Die on Stranger Things?

While the thought of Eddie dying a true hero gives viewers some comfort, it's still incredibly upsetting to see him fighting a horde of Demobats. According to the actor who portrayed Eddie, Joe Quinn, it was a conscious decision that Eddie made and stood by: not to run away from what was coming.

Protecting not only his best pal Dustin, but an entire town, Eddie loses his life. And while many would agree that his death was the most emotional yet, others could argue that it wasn't the most underserved. Looking back at the show, we have already had a character who literally did nothing wrong sacrifice himself to save his loved ones.

Bob Newby, Joyce's former boyfriend, met his death at the Hawkins National Laboratory when it was attacked by Demodogs. This shocking scene has stayed with many viewers for the longest time, and many feel that it was even more unfair than Eddie's simply because of the man's pure intentions throughout his character's run.

While both deaths are equally tragic, there is a reason why Eddie's death hits so much harder than Bob's, even though the circumstances are somewhat similar. While Bob was a grown man with a lot to live for and a life full of experiences, Eddie was just a teenager at the beginning of his life.
